Manchester United have confirmed that Brazilian youngster Rodrigo Possebon will spend next season on loan at Portuguese side Sporting Braga.
The midfielder joined United from Internacional in January 2008 and made his first appearance for the club last season against Newcastle United.
A statement on United’s official website said: “Brazilian midfielder Rodrigo Possebon will spend the entire 2009/10 season on loan at Portuguese side Sporting Braga.”
Reports suggest Sir Alex Ferguson wants Possebon to gain experience before moving back to Old Trafford for a chance to become a regular at United.
